Mrs. Wilkes Dining Room

Mrs. Wilkes Dining Room is a staple of the Savannah restaurant scene, serving up classic Southern dishes with a side of old-fashioned hospitality. But don’t leave without trying their homemade desserts. The menu changes daily, but you can expect to find a selection of pies, cobblers, cakes, and more. The classic peach cobbler is a fan favorite, with its sweet, juicy peaches and buttery crust. Or try the decadent chocolate cake, which is sure to satisfy even the most discerning sweet tooth.

If you’re looking for something a bit lighter, Mrs. Wilkes also offers a selection of sorbets and fruit cobblers. The raspberry sorbet is the perfect way to cool down after a hot summer day, while the blueberry cobbler is sure to bring a smile to your face. No matter what you choose, you’re sure to leave Mrs. Wilkes feeling satisfied.

Mrs. Wilkes Dining Room is located at 107 West Jones Street in Savannah, GA. It’s open Monday through Saturday from 8:00am to 3:00pm, so be sure to get there early to get your fill of Southern hospitality and delicious desserts.

River Street Sweets

If you’re looking for something a bit more traditional, then River Street Sweets is the place for you. This classic candy store has been serving up sugary treats since 1974. You can find everything from classic taffy and saltwater taffy to hand-dipped chocolates and homemade fudge. The selection changes daily, but you can always expect to find something sweet.

River Street Sweets also has a selection of unique creations. The praline pecan pie is a fan favorite, with its crunchy pecans and creamy filling. The banana split ice cream cake is a cool and creamy treat, and the key lime pie is a tart and tangy delight.

River Street Sweets is located at 12 West River Street in Savannah, GA. It’s open Monday through Sunday from 10:00am to 10:00pm, so be sure to stop by and grab a sweet treat.

Leopold’s Ice Cream

For a cool and creamy treat, head to Leopold’s Ice Cream. This classic ice cream parlor has been serving up scoops since 1919. You can find everything from classic flavors like vanilla and chocolate to seasonal favorites like pumpkin and peppermint. The selection changes daily, so you can always find something new and exciting.

Leopold’s also has a selection of unique creations. The s’more sundae is a fan favorite, with its layers of graham crackers, marshmallows, and chocolate. The blueberry cheesecake ice cream is a tart and tangy treat, and the cookie dough ice cream is sure to please even the pickiest of eaters.

Leopold’s Ice Cream is located at 212 E. Broughton Street in Savannah, GA. It’s open Monday through Sunday from 12:00pm to 10:00pm, so be sure to stop by and grab a sweet treat.
